Product Category: Integrated Circuit

Basic Information Overview: - Category: Analog-to-Digital Converter (ADC) - Use: The ADS1113IRUGT is used to convert analog voltage signals into digital data for processing in various electronic systems. - Characteristics: This ADC features low power consumption, high precision, and small package size. - Package: The ADS1113IRUGT comes in a small QFN-10 package. - Essence: The essence of this product lies in its ability to accurately and efficiently convert analog signals to digital data. - Packaging/Quantity: It is typically available in reels containing 2500 units.

Specifications: - Resolution: 16-bit - Channels: 4 single-ended or 2 differential inputs - Input Voltage Range: ±256mV to ±6.144V - Conversion Rate: Up to 860 samples per second (SPS) - Interface: I2C-compatible

Functional Features: - High-Resolution ADC: Provides 16-bit resolution for accurate conversion of analog signals. - Low Power Consumption: Ideal for battery-powered applications due to its low current consumption. - Flexible Input Configurations: Supports both single-ended and differential input configurations for versatile use.

Advantages and Disadvantages: - Advantages: - High precision and accuracy - Low power consumption - Small package size - Disadvantages: - Limited number of input channels compared to some other ADCs - May require external components for certain applications

Working Principles: The ADS1113IRUGT operates by sampling the analog input voltage and converting it into a corresponding digital value using its internal ADC circuitry. This digital data can then be processed and utilized by the connected microcontroller or system.

Detailed Application Field Plans: - Industrial Automation: Used for monitoring and control systems in industrial settings. - Portable Instruments: Integrated into handheld measurement devices for accurate data acquisition. - Consumer Electronics: Employed in various consumer electronic products requiring precise analog-to-digital conversion.

Detailed and Complete Alternative Models: 1. ADS1115: Offers additional input channels and programmable gain amplifiers. 2. MCP3424: Provides similar functionality with different interface options and input ranges.

  1. What is the ADS1113IRUGT?

    • The ADS1113IRUGT is a precision analog-to-digital converter (ADC) with an integrated amplifier and reference designed for applications requiring high accuracy and low power consumption.
  2. What is the input voltage range of the ADS1113IRUGT?

    • The input voltage range of the ADS1113IRUGT is ±256mV to ±6.144V, making it suitable for a wide range of sensor and signal conditioning applications.
  3. What is the resolution of the ADS1113IRUGT?

    • The ADS1113IRUGT offers 16-bit resolution, providing high precision in converting analog signals to digital data.
  4. What are the key features of the ADS1113IRUGT?

    • Some key features of the ADS1113IRUGT include low power consumption, programmable data rate, integrated comparator, and internal oscillator.
  5. How can the ADS1113IRUGT be interfaced with microcontrollers or processors?

    • The ADS1113IRUGT can be interfaced with microcontrollers or processors using I2C interface, allowing for easy integration into various digital systems.
  6. What are some typical applications of the ADS1113IRUGT?

    • Typical applications of the ADS1113IRUGT include industrial process control, portable instrumentation, smart sensors, and battery monitoring systems.
  7. What is the operating temperature range of the ADS1113IRUGT?

    • The ADS1113IRUGT has an operating temperature range of -40°C to +125°C, enabling its use in harsh environmental conditions.
  8. Does the ADS1113IRUGT support single-ended or differential input configurations?

    • The ADS1113IRUGT supports both single-ended and differential input configurations, offering flexibility in measuring various types of signals.
  9. Can the ADS1113IRUGT operate on a single power supply?

    • Yes, the ADS1113IRUGT can operate on a single power supply, simplifying its integration into different power architectures.
  10. What are the power consumption characteristics of the ADS1113IRUGT?

    • The ADS1113IRUGT features low power consumption, with typical current consumption of 150µA at 3.3V and 35µA at 1.8V, making it suitable for battery-powered applications.
